A North Carolina father charged with using eyedrops to fatally poison his wife in 2018 is now accused of sickening his daughter with the same concoction five years later.
The poisoning – which landed the child in the hospital – was intended to implicate his wife's parents, John and Susie Robinson, in Stacy's death, the local outlet reported.
